Experienced 35-year old American (has also Libyan passport) 198cm swingman Tony Mitchell (college: Alabama) left Union de Santa Fe (La Liga). In 7 games in Argentina he averaged 12.4ppg, 3.1rpg and 1.0spg this season.
Part of last season he spent at Al Ahly Cairo (Superleague) in Egyptian league. He also played for Al Alhy Benghazi (D1) in Libya.
He has tried to make it to the NBA and played in the NBA Pro Summer League in 2015. Mitchell has been regularly called to the Libyan Senior National Team since 2023.
He is a very experienced player. Mitchell has quite traveled the world as his pro career brought him to seventeen different countries on six different continents (Europe, Asia, Latin America, Australia, Africa and of course North America). He has played previously professionally in Australia (Taipans), Bahrain (Al-Muharraq and Bahrain Club), China (Chongqing), Israel (Hapoel Eilat), Italy (Cantu and Pistoia), Lebanon (Beirut Club), Morocco (AS Sale), Philippines, Puerto Rico (Fajardo and Indios), Russia, Spain, Taiwan (TB Mitchellrobears), Uruguay (Aguada), Venezuela (Trotamundos), NBA (Miami Heat) and Dominican Republic (Soles). He played in the final of Egyptian League in 2024.
Among many awards he was voted to Latinbasket.com Puerto Rican BSN All-Imports Team back in 2017.
He graduated from University of Alabama in 2012 and it is his 13th (hopefully lucky) (!!!) season in pro basketball.
